How do independent contractor side gigs typically structure communication and collaboration with clients?

As an independent contractor working a side gig, you are generally responsible for establishing clear communication channels with your clients, often via email, project management tools, or scheduled calls. Unlike traditional employment, you may not have a supervisor or team to rely on, so proactive communication, setting expectations, and keeping clients updated are key to success. Many contractors use online platforms to manage deliverables and timelines, ensuring transparency and efficiency. Building strong professional relationships through reliable and timely communication can lead to repeat business and referrals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Independent Contractor in side gigs,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Independent Contractor in side gigs, you need strong self-management, time management, and specialized skills relevant to your chosen field, often supported by prior experience or training. Familiarity with digital platforms (such as Upwork, Fiverr, or gig-specific apps), invoicing tools, and basic contract management is beneficial. Exceptional communication, adaptability, and self-motivation help you stand out when dealing with diverse clients and changing assignments. These abilities ensure you can deliver high-quality work, manage multiple projects efficiently, and build a reliable reputation for ongoing opportunities.

What are independent contractor side gigs?

Independent contractor side gigs are flexible, short-term jobs where you work for yourself rather than as an employee. These gigs can range from freelance writing and graphic design to ridesharing or delivery services, and you are usually paid per project or task. As an independent contractor, you're responsible for managing your own taxes, expenses, and work schedule. Many people choose side gigs to earn extra income, gain experience, or have control over their work hours. It's important to understand that you typically don’t receive employee benefits and must handle your own business obligations.

Job Summary

AmeriPharma is seeking a dedicated Registered Nurse (RN) with expertise in home infusion therapy to join our team. This role combines infusion therapy and patient education, providing both in-home care and valuable support to patients undergoing treatments such as TPN, IVIG, and IV biologics.


The RN will be responsible for providing telephone and in-person advice and education to patients. This role requires offering interventions, counseling, and support services that require significant nursing knowledge, judgment, and skills in psychological, biological, physical, and social sciences. Under the supervision of the Director of Nursing, the RN will make decisions based on their education, nursing experience, and clinical guidelines, ensuring optimal compliance and persistence in home infusion programs.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Conduct in-home infusion therapy visits with patients according to the plan of care.
  • Prepare clinical/nursing notes and document patient interventions in both clinical and non-clinical records consistently.
  • Act as a clinical resource, working collaboratively with other pharmacy departments.
  • Maintain knowledge of drug side effects and interactions.
  • Offer telephone and in-person patient education on therapy protocols, drug side effects, and home infusion procedures.
  • Ensure patients understand their therapy plans, medications, and the importance of adherence.
  • During initial and ongoing consultations, serve as a patient liaison between the patient, their family, and the pharmacy to ensure a seamless therapy process.
  • Perform comprehensive, initial, and periodic head-to-toe assessments for patients and initiate preventative and rehabilitative care.
  • Use health assessment data, and input from the agency team, the physician, the patient, and the family to determine patient needs.
  • Manage patient and family expectations regarding services, outcomes, and discharge goals.
  • Establish primary and secondary diagnoses based on patient assessment and home health care focus.
  • Develop care plans with skilled interventions, medical supplies, and necessary services to meet goals.
  • Regularly evaluate patient progress, in collaboration with team members, and revise care plans as needed.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.


Qualifications

  • Graduate of an accredited nursing school with a current RN state license.
  • 2+ years of experience in home infusion and infusion centers.
  • 2+ Experience with IV Immunoglobulins and IV Biologics. CRNI certification(Certified Registered Nurse Infusion) is preferred.
  • Experience with peripheral IV starts, infusion therapy, and phlebotomy for both adult and pediatric patients is preferred
  • Effective interpersonal, time management, and organizational skills.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Organizational ability to maintain consistently accurate records.
  • Ability to direct information to the appropriate healthcare provider.
  • Proficient in computer skills, including word processing, and efficient use of the internet and email.
  • Current CPR and BLS (Red Cross and AHA) certification, valid driver's license, reliable transportation, and automobile insurance.
